Driving Growth in Metal Fabrication: Proven Strategies and Best Practices
Metal fabrication businesses are enterprises that specialize in transforming raw metal materials into finished products through various manufacturing processes. These businesses typically offer a range of services including cutting, bending, welding, machining, and assembling metal components. They cater to diverse industries such as automotive, aerospace, construction, and manufacturing, providing customized solutions to meet specific client requirements.
The Role of Advanced Tools and Technologies
Metal fabrication businesses utilize advanced tools and technologies such as laser cutting machines, CNC machining centers, and robotic welding systems to ensure precise and efficient production. Skilled professionals including welders, fabricators, engineers, and quality control experts collaborate to deliver high-quality products that adhere to industry standards and specifications. By leveraging their expertise, craftsmanship, and technological advancements, metal fabrication businesses play a crucial role in meeting the metal component needs of various industries.
Investing in Advanced Technologies and Equipment
Investing in advanced technologies and equipment is crucial for driving growth in metal fabrication. Automation, robotics, and computer numerical control (CNC) systems streamline production processes, enhance precision, and increase efficiency. These advanced tools allow for faster turnaround times, improved quality, and the ability to handle complex designs with greater ease.

Embracing Sustainable Practices
Embracing sustainable practices such as reducing waste and energy consumption not only benefits the environment but also improves cost-effectiveness. Implementing sustainable practices can lead to significant cost savings in the long run while contributing to a greener future. Metal fabrication businesses can achieve this by optimizing processes, recycling materials, and adopting energy-efficient technologies.
